Seals

Modern windows feature seals that shield the glass from the elements and humidity. They function by forming an air space between the panes, Window Repairs and then sealing it with a rubbery-elastic sealant. The result is a highly insulated window, commonly called an IGU. (IGU), which can drastically reduce the transfer of cold and heat through the home.

Seal failures are a typical issue for windows with insulation. If they aren't taken care of, your energy costs and draftiness can increase. However, there are methods you can take to make your window seals last longer and prevent them from failing.

In the beginning, you should examine your windows at least every year. This will help you to ensure that you don't find any cracks in the seals that could allow moisture in your home. In addition you should sand and paint the frames and sash as well as a few of the frames every six months. This will help limit any damage from the elements, particularly during winter.

You can also add an external coating to your window to make it more water-resistant. But this could damage the sealant, so it's recommended to leave the job to a professional.

If a window seal is damaged it is generally easy to see that there is some form of moisture between the panes. The seal could be broken if it is surrounded by water droplets, fog, or other forms of condensation.

A damaged window seal could also be seen in items in the outside of your windows that appear oddly distorted, even though they're not getting fogged up. This is due to the insulating gases between the panes are being let out and the window isn't properly sealed.

Silicone is the most sought-after sealant for windows resealing. However, it's not your only choice. There are other options, including silicone, asphalt based on oil, and latex.

Hinges

Your windows' hinges play an an important role in ensuring that your windows are closed and opened properly. It is possible to replace them if they're damaged, rusted or simply not working correctly.

There are a few different types of hinges that could be used on window sashes. You can find them in a range of sizes and styles It's vital to select the proper hinges for your home.

Ball bearing hinges are a popular choice for heavy doors, and they have a permanently-lubricated system to keep them working smoothly. They are also a great option for doors in the interior that are frequently opened and closed, such as cabinet doors.

Concealed hinges can also be utilized to make kitchen cabinets. They have a contemporary, sleek design that hides the hinges from view. These are a popular option for commercial buildings since they can be installed without needing any extra holes in the door.

Piano hinges are another type of continuous hinge, and they're usually found on doors to cabinets or storage boxes. They feature a central pin and leaves that extend over the length of the hinge.
